Dalen Hotel

Dalen Hotel is an iconic adventure hotel dating back to 1894, offering guests a unique and historic experience in a stunning natural setting by the Telemark Canal. With its majestic architecture, charming accommodation and excellent facilities, the hotel is a fabulous destination for both relaxation and historic experiences.

Like a fairytale castle


Dalen Hotel is situated at the end of the beautiful Telemark Canal in the heart of Norway, rising out of the lush green landscape like a fairytale castle. It's easy to get here by car, bus and boat. This includes the MS Henrik Ibsen that offers a unique way to explore the Telemark Canal. The hotel is the ideal starting base for both nature lovers and culture vultures seeking a memorable experience.


Classic luxury in a historic setting


The hotel's 49 historic rooms have been carefully restored in their original style, creating a unique 19th century atmosphere. The majestic fireplace and beautiful lounge areas offer guests a wonderful setting to relax, while the Bandak Restaurant provides elegant culinary experiences inspired by French cuisine. In fine weather, you can step outside onto the terrace to relish st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Enjoy for unique stay in this historic setting where modern facilities offer a high level of comfort and classic luxury.


A destination for adventure


Dalen Hotel is much more than a place to stay. Prepare for a trip back in time! The historic architecture and atmosphere offer a rare glimpse into the grand hotel culture of the 1800s. The Bandak Restaurant is a highlight for food lovers, serving exquisite dishes inspired by French culinary traditions with various set menus to showcase the excellent produce. With its unique location by the Telemark Canal, and lots to see and do, including boat trips and historic attractions, guests can look forward to a memorable and adventurous stay.
